This spring, MCE partnered with Bigelow Laboratory for Ocean Sciences and Gulf of Maine Research Institute to host Algal Innovations: Beyond Food, a collaborative event exploring the emerging opportunities for algae in biotechnology, agriculture, materials, and climate innovation. The conversation highlighted the momentum building around Maine’s blue economy and brought together researchers, entrepreneurs, and industry leaders from across the region.
Shortly thereafter, Tom Rainey participated in Leadership in the High North 2026 in Bangor, where he served on a panel focused on Arctic business development, trade opportunities, and Maine’s role in the evolving North Atlantic economy.
The symposium included participation from the Icelandic Ambassador to the United States and leaders from academia, government, the Maine National Guard and industry.

That momentum carried into the 2026 Maine Entrepreneurs Summit at the University of Southern Maine, where entrepreneurs, investors, mentors, and ecosystem partners gathered for a day of learning, connection, and inspiration. Attendees heard from Maine State Economist Amanda Rector, participated in workshops and networking opportunities, and cheered on the finalists during the annual Top Gun Showcase competition.
This year’s Top Gun Showcase winner, Saco Bay Sea Farms, took home the $25,000 grand prize sponsored by Maine Technology Institute.
